Why most startup blogs fail (and it's not the writing)

Ran a quick audit of 40 early-stage SaaS blogs this month. Almost none of them had a traffic problem because of bad writing. They had a consistency problem.


The pattern: founder writes 3 great posts in month one, gets busy, blog goes quiet for 8 weeks, momentum dies, Google deprioritizes the domain.


SEO content compounds — but only if it ships on a schedule. A blog that publishes 4 mediocre-but-consistent posts a month will out-rank a blog that publishes 1 brilliant post a quarter, almost every time.


If you're a founder and content keeps sliding off your to-do list because product/sales eats your week, that's the actual bottleneck to fix — not your prose. Outsourcing the writing (even just the drafting) to someone who ships on schedule usually beats trying to protect 4 hours a week for it yourself.
